微软公司软件测试工程师面试技巧.docxVIP

微软公司软件测试工程师面试技巧.docx

本文档由用户AI专业辅助创建,并经网站质量审核通过
  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

第PAGE页共NUMPAGES页

2026年微软公司软件测试工程师面试技巧

一、单选题(共5题,每题2分)

考察点:基础测试概念、缺陷管理、测试流程

1.题目:在软件测试中,下列哪项不属于黑盒测试的范畴?

A.等价类划分

B.决策表测试

C.代码覆盖率分析

D.场景法测试

答案:C

解析:黑盒测试不关注代码实现,而是基于需求进行测试。等价类划分、决策表测试、场景法测试都属于黑盒测试方法,而代码覆盖率分析属于白盒测试范畴。

2.题目:当多个测试用例发现同一缺陷时,这通常表明:

A.测试用例设计质量高

B.该缺陷是偶发性的

C.需要进一步调查潜在的系统性问题

D.测试人员缺乏经验

答案:C

解析:多个测试用例发现同一缺陷,说明问题可能存在于软件的某个关键逻辑或模块,需要深入排查。

3.题目:在敏捷开发模式下,测试工程师最应该关注:

A.编写详细的测试计划

B.执行完整的回归测试

C.与开发团队紧密协作,进行持续测试

D.等待完整的功能开发后再开始测试

答案:C

解析:敏捷强调快速迭代和协作,测试工程师需与开发同步进行,尽早介入测试。

4.题目:下列哪种缺陷优先级最高?

A.严重影响用户核心功能

B.轻微界面显示问题

C.部分用户无法登录

D.编码规范错误

答案:A

解析:缺陷优先级由其对业务的影响程度决定,严重影响核心功能的问题需最先修复。

5.题目:在自动化测试中,以下哪项技术最适合用于测试Web应用的UI界面?

A.性能测试

B.API接口测试

C.可用性测试

D.UI自动化框架(如Selenium)

答案:D

解析:UI自动化框架(如Selenium)专门用于模拟用户操作,测试界面交互。

二、多选题(共5题,每题3分)

考察点:测试策略、性能测试、安全测试

1.题目:以下哪些属于性能测试的指标?

A.响应时间

B.并发用户数

C.内存占用率

D.缺陷数量

答案:A,B,C

解析:性能测试关注系统的响应时间、并发能力、资源利用率等,而缺陷数量属于质量度量。

2.题目:在进行安全测试时,测试工程师可能需要关注:

A.SQL注入

B.跨站脚本(XSS)

C.密码复杂度

D.代码注释是否完整

答案:A,B,C

解析:安全测试重点包括漏洞扫描、注入攻击、权限控制等,而代码注释与测试无关。

3.题目:以下哪些方法可以用于测试用例设计?

A.等价类划分

B.边界值分析

C.用例依赖性分析

D.决策表测试

答案:A,B,D

解析:用例依赖性分析不属于测试用例设计方法,而是测试管理范畴。

4.题目:在移动应用测试中,以下哪些属于兼容性测试的内容?

A.不同操作系统版本

B.不同设备屏幕尺寸

C.网络环境(WiFi/4G/5G)

D.应用商店版本适配

答案:A,B,C

解析:兼容性测试关注应用在不同环境下的表现,而应用商店版本适配属于发布管理。

5.题目:以下哪些属于测试过程中常见的风险?

A.测试用例不充分

B.缺陷修复不及时

C.测试环境不稳定

D.项目时间紧张

答案:A,B,C,D

解析:测试风险包括资源、时间、环境、人员等多方面因素。

三、简答题(共4题,每题5分)

考察点:测试流程、缺陷管理、自动化测试

1.题目:简述测试用例设计的“错误猜测法”及其适用场景。

答案:

错误猜测法是一种基于测试人员经验,预先判断程序可能存在的错误并设计测试用例的方法。例如,对于财务软件,测试人员可能猜测输入非法金额会引发异常。

适用场景:核心功能模块、历史问题频发的模块、业务逻辑复杂的地方。

2.题目:描述测试过程中缺陷跟踪的典型流程。

答案:

1.新建缺陷(记录标题、复现步骤、截图等);

2.分配缺陷给开发人员;

3.开发人员修复并验证;

4.测试人员验证修复效果,关闭缺陷;

5.若未解决,重新打开或升级优先级。

3.题目:解释自动化测试与手动测试的区别,并说明自动化测试的局限性。

答案:

区别:

-自动化测试:通过脚本执行,速度快,适合回归测试;

-手动测试:人工操作,灵活,适合探索性测试。

局限性:

-需要前期投入,维护成本高;

-不适合探索性或易变需求测试;

-无法完全替代手动测试。

4.题目:在测试过程中,如何评估测试用例的有效性?

答案:

-覆盖率:是否覆盖所有需求;

-可执行性:步骤是否清晰;

-预期结果准确性:是否合理;

-重用性:能否用于后续版本。

四、论述题(共2题,每题10分)

考察点:测试策略、团队协作

1.题目:结合微软的产品特点(如Office365、Azure云服务),论述

文档评论(0)

蜈蚣 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档